pet·rous part of tem·po·ral bone

[TA] the part of the temporal bone that contains the structures of the inner ear and the second part of the internal carotid artery; in prenatal life it appears as a separate ossification center. Synonym(s): pars petrosa ossis temporalis [TA], periotic bone, petrosal bone, petrous bone, petrous pyramid
